Money & Currency

Get a travel card →
💵
Local currency

Euro, EUR

🏦
Where to exchange

ATMs inside banks give the best rates; avoid exchange bureaux at the airport and main railway station which add 5-10% fee.

💳
Cards & contactless

Debit and credit cards accepted almost everywhere, including kiosks, taxis, and market stalls; contactless and mobile pay (e.g. Apple Pay) are standard; always carry a small amount of cash for very small shops or public saunas.

🪙
Tipping etiquette

Tipping is not expected in Finland; rounding up to the nearest euro for good service is appreciated but optional; never obligatory in taxis or hotels.

Eat, Shop & Travel on a Budget

Cheap car hire →
Cheap coffee

Filter coffee from a café or lunch buffet costs around €3–4; a small takeaway coffee from a supermarket cafeteria is €2–2.50.

🥪
Best-value lunch

A daily lunch buffet (lounas) at a local restaurant costs €10–14 and includes a hot main, salad, bread, and coffee.

🍝
Affordable dinner

A main course at a casual Italian or pub restaurant ranges €14–18; pizza or kebab from a kiosk is €9–12.

🌮
Street food & cheap eats

Kebab, pizza, and grill stands near the metro station and along Kauppakeskus Iso Omena are the main cheap-eats spots; no dedicated street food market in this area.

🛒
Budget groceries

S-market, K-Market, and Lidl are the main budget supermarkets in 02150; Lidl is cheapest for basics.

👕
Affordable clothes

Affordable high-street brands (H&M, Cubus) at the Iso Omena shopping centre; no dedicated market for clothes.

🎫
Cheapest way around

A single HSL ticket for zones AB costs €3.10 (adult); the cheapest way is a 30-day season ticket at €63.80; from the airport take the I or P train to Espoo (€4.10 with a single AB ticket), not the airport express bus.

💡
Money-saving tips

1) Use the lunch buffet between 11 and 14 for the best-value meal. 2) Buy the HSL mobile app ticket rather than paper to avoid a €1 surcharge. 3) Fill up a reusable bottle at public taps – tap water is excellent and free.

For all emergencies in Finland, dial 112. This is the single number for police, fire, and ambulance. If you need non-urgent medical advice, call the medical helpline on 116117. For other non-emergency matters, contact the Espoo city switchboard at +358 9 816 21.
